World War II, also called Second World War, conflict that involved virtually every part of the world during the years 1939–45. The principal belligerents were the Axis powers — Germany, Italy, and Japan —and the Allies— France, Great Britain, the United States, the Soviet Union, and, to a lesser extent, China.

World War II began in Europe on September 1, 1939, when Germany invaded Poland. Great Britain and France responded by declaring war on Germany on September 3. The war between the U.S.S.R. and Germany began on June 22, 1941, with Operation Barbarossa, the German invasion of the Soviet Union.

Conservatives objected to President Lyndon B. Johnson's expansion of federal government power, particularly through his Great Society programs, which aimed to eliminate poverty and racial inequality.
They argued that these initiatives encroached on states' rights and individual liberties. For example, conservatives opposed the creation of Medicare and Medicaid, believing that healthcare should be managed by the private sector, not the government.
They also criticized the Elementary and Secondary Education Act, fearing federal control over local schools would undermine community values. Furthermore, conservatives claimed that the War on Poverty led to dependency on government assistance, discouraging self-sufficiency.
Overall, conservatives viewed Johnson's expansion of federal power as an overreach that threatened both states' rights and individual freedoms.

The two cities on China's coast that were owned by European nations until the 1990s and were returned to China as specially governed regions are:
1- Hong Kong: Prior to being returned to China in 1997 as a Special Administrative Region (SAR) in accordance with the "one country, two systems" principle, Hong Kong was a British colony.
2- Macau: Macau was a Portuguese colony until 1999 when it was returned to China and also became a Special Administrative Region (SAR) with a similar arrangement to Hong Kong.
Both Hong Kong and Macau have a high degree of autonomy and maintain separate legal, economic, and political systems compared to mainland China.

The statement is not accurate. Punk music is actually defined by its rebellious and anti-authoritarian attitude, which stands in contrast to the more mainstream and commercial rock music of the time.
It was a reaction against the perceived conformity and lack of authenticity in popular music, and sought to create a raw and honest sound that reflected the frustrations and anger of the youth culture of the 1970s. Punk music emerged as a subculture in the mid-1970s, primarily in the United Kingdom and the United States. It was characterized by its fast, aggressive sound and its rejection of mainstream values and societal norms. Its lyrics often dealt with political and social issues, and its fashion and visual style emphasized individuality and DIY aesthetics. Rather than seeking to appeal to the middle-class, punk music was often associated with working-class youth and aimed to challenge the status quo and inspire rebellion against authority.

The Fourteenth Amendment to the Constitution of the United States ('XIV Amendment') is one of the post-Civil War amendments, and includes, among others, the Due Process Clause and the Equal Protection Clause. It was proposed on June 13, 1866, and ratified on July 9, 1868.
The amendment provides a broad definition of national citizenship, which overrides the decision of Dred Scott v. Sandford (1857), who had excluded slaves and their descendants, from possessing constitutional rights. It requires states to provide equal protection before the law to all persons (not just citizens) within their jurisdictions. The importance of the Fourteenth Amendment was exemplified when it was interpreted to prohibit racial segregation in public schools in the Brown v. Case. Board of Education.
